    Your Apple Watch may not be as accurate as you think, new studies show

    Researchers at the University of Mississippi conducted a meta -analysis of 56 studies that compared Apple Watch with reference tools when measuring factors such as heart rate, phase counting and energy burning. Although there is always some expected mistake, we have a more definite answer how much you should stock up in the number you see on your watch.

    Apple watches are good at measurement measures and heart rate measurements

    Meta analysis results shows that Apple Watch accurately measures your heart rate and phased count. We know that the absolute percentage of the error reported for every health metric is based on measuring (standard method of measuring accuracy).

    The heart rate was a mistake of 4.43 %, while the phase count was an 8.17 % error. Anything less than 10 % is considered to be the best, so you should feel confident that your Apple Watch says your heart rate and phased counting day.

    However, you should not rely on energy costs metric

    The same cannot be said for energy costs or burning calories. The percentage for this matriculation was 27.96 %. This is an important jump in error. Researchers found energy costs wrong in all tested activities, including walking, walking, mixed intensity and cycling.

    This is not a new problem. Numerous studies have shown that smart watches and trackers do not do a great job of calculating calories. They can range from 40 % to 80 %. A different study has revealed that the Apple Watch Series 9 can vary in energy costs and heart rate measures in skin color.

    Although this study was specific to Apple watches, I expect similar trends in other devices as they often measure similar. One study found that when the calorie was burned, the feet of 27 % had an average error.

    Smart watchs calculate how many calories you burn throughout the day, using factors such as your movement, heart rate and data from the sensor inside the clock. Other factors, such as your age, weight and gender, are also included in this calculation. None of them will be 100 % accurate.
